gitlabci: Add needed ENV vars.

abc8fb98 uses an feature of rayon
that's behind a compile time flag. The flag was added to the
buildscript and flatpak manifest but not in the CI config.
Do not ask me why either CI job does not use meson or the flatpak
manifest. I hate computers...
......@@ -5,9 +5,9 @@ stages:
.cargo_test_template: &cargo_test
stage: test
# variables:
# RUSTFLAGS: "-C link-dead-code"
RUSTFLAGS: "--cfg rayon_unstable"
- apt-get update -yqq
......@@ -59,7 +59,7 @@ flatpak:
# Build the flatpak repo
- flatpak-builder --run app org.gnome.Hammond.json meson --prefix=/app --libdir=/app/lib _build
- flatpak-builder --run app org.gnome.Hammond.json ninja -C _build install
- flatpak-builder --run app org.gnome.Hammond.json RUSTFLAGS="--cfg rayon_unstable" ninja -C _build install
- flatpak-builder --finish-only app org.gnome.Hammond.json
- flatpak build-export repo app
